Brought to you by Specialty Property. Selected sculptures are on exhibit from June 2007 through May 2009 in downtown Waco at Indian Springs Park and around the Waco Convention Center. The Waco National Sculpture Exhibition brings unique sculptures by renowned and emerging artists into Waco’s downtown in order to promote art in public places.
